Q: Is 137,548 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 137,548 is not a prime number.

Why is 137,548 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 137548 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 137 251 274 502 548 1,004 34,387 68,774 and 137,548, with no remainder.

Since 137,548 cannot be divided by just 1 and 137,548, it is not a prime number.
